Abstract

Using nanoparticles of CeO2 and ZrO2 prepared by a chemical precipitationmethod as starting materials, single-phase cubic Ce0.5Zr0.5O2 solid solution(c-Ce0.5Zr0.5O2) has been synthesized under 3.1 GPa at 1073 K for the first time.The EPR and XPS measurements show that there exists no Ce3+ in it and thatthe Ce4+ has not been reduced to Ce3+ after annealing. The transportmechanism is ionic for the c-Ce0.5Zr0.5O2. The bulk conductivity is thesame as that of CeO2, but smaller than that of Y2O3-stabilized ZrO2.
